Spout Top / Flat Bottom FIBC Bags

Spout top flat bottom FIBC bags give buyers a guided fill point at the top while keeping the simplest possible pallet base at the bottom. This format is used when the loading side needs better containment or better alignment with filling equipment, but the bag will still be discharged by tipping, cutting, or one-time release rather than through a sewn bottom spout.

What This Configuration Is

About this bag configuration.

The spout top / flat bottom configuration combines a top fill spout with a flat sewn base. The top spout supports cleaner, more controlled filling into the bag body, while the flat bottom keeps the bag stable on a pallet and easy to handle in storage and transport. This format is a practical choice for powders, ingredients, resins, and industrial materials that benefit from guided filling but do not require a controlled discharge outlet.

Industries & Applications

Where this bag fits.

  • Food ingredients loaded through guided filling equipment but discharged by cut-open emptying
  • Plastic pellets and specialty resin where top containment matters more than bottom metered flow
  • Fine powders that benefit from controlled filling into the bag body
  • Industrial additives and dry compounds with a cleaner top-loading requirement
  • Chemical powders where loading containment matters but a bottom spout is not required

Specs at a Glance

Technical reference for quoting discussions.

Specifications below reflect common commercial ranges and standard options for this bag style.

Datasheet XTRX-STFB · 2026
01 Configuration Spout top / flat bottom
02 Top inlet Fabric fill spout - 14 in to 20 in diameter typical
03 Bottom construction Flat sewn base
04 Typical capacity 500 kg to 1,500 kg
05 Safe working load (SWL) 500 kg to 1,500 kg standard
06 Safety factor 5:1 standard; 6:1 available on request
07 Body fabric Woven polypropylene - coated or uncoated
08 Liner option Available on request
09 Loop style Cross-corner standard; alternatives available
10 Bag dimensions 35 x 35 x 40 in to 42 x 42 x 60 in common range
11 Discharge method Tip, cut, or open-base emptying
